2. Scientific method of storing edamame
1. Short-term storage (consume within 3 days)
Put the fresh edamame into a fresh-keeping bag, seal it after releasing the air, and place it in the refrigerator (around 4°C). It can maintain the emerald green color and fresh taste.
2. Long-term storage (more than 1 month)
Use the quick-freezing method: blanch the edamame for 1-2 minutes, freeze quickly, drain the water, and freeze in portions. Experimental data shows:

4. Storage Tips
1.Preprocessing is important: Damaged pods need to be removed before storage to avoid cross-contamination.
2.Packaging skills: Pack according to single serving size to avoid repeated thawing.
3.Thawing method: It is recommended to defrost slowly in the refrigerator or cook directly to reduce nutrient loss.
4.Tips for preventing discoloration: Add a little salt or cooking oil when blanching to help maintain the green color.
